Welcome to Fredericksburg, Virginia, where history meets modern living along the Rappahannock River. Located 47 miles south of Washington, D.C., this historic community offers renters both small-town atmosphere and metropolitan convenience. The downtown district showcases preserved 18th and 19th-century architecture, complemented by local restaurants, art galleries, and independent shops. Housing options include contemporary apartment communities and historic townhomes, with current average rents starting at $1,272 for studios and reaching $2,356 for three-bedroom units. The rental market has seen modest growth, with year-over-year increases between 2.6% and 4.6% across different unit sizes.
The city features several outdoor spaces, including Old Mill Park along the Rappahannock River and Alum Spring Park, known for its historic stone formations. The University of Mary Washington campus enhances the area with its academic presence and cultural offerings.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ources.
